What is the TEF Certificate?
The Test d'Évaluation de Français is a standardized evaluation designed to assess French language skills in listening, speaking, reading, and composing. The TEF is administered by the Chamber of Commerce and Industry of Paris (CCIP) and is globally recognized.

Credibility Period
The TEF certificate is Legitimate TEF Certificate for two years from the date of evaluation. After this period, candidates might need to retake the test to show their present level of fluency.
